Summary:
use the 3 dots icons as view-more-symbolic, as traditionally in
the iconography of most systems those are for menus of actions
that didn't fit in a toolbar (as the overflow-menu name tells)
while the 3 lines one means the main menu of an application and
should always appear at most in a single place in a whole app
this makes it less confusing as users will use our apps together
apps written in other toolkits, web pages where this is common as
well, as well apps on their phones which will all use this paradigm.
adapt the horizontal version too, to look like what firefox uses
tough i would make it black as well, as now it may always look disabled
